🔎 Component 2: How to be able to Vet an Oriental Manufacturer (Step by Step)
Step 1: Check Their Certifications
Minimum requirement: GMP (Good Manufacturing Practices). Ideally also ISO 9001, Kosher, Halal, and organic (if needed).
Red light: “We can provide any certificate you want” without showing current, verifiable documents.
Step two: Request a COA (Certificate of Analysis)
A real COA includes:
– HPLC or UV testing technique
– Purity percentage
– Heavy metals (Pb, Seeing that, Hg, Cd)
rapid Residual solvents
instructions Microbial limits
instructions Batch number & retest date
Reddish flag: No set number, or COA is dated even more than 12 months ago.

Reputable suppliers offer you free samples (you pay shipping). Analyze in a thirdparty lab if you’re buying bulk. Normal issues:
– More affordable purity than claimed
– Adulteration together with cheaper fillers
– High residual solvents (especially for supercritical CO₂ extracts)
Action 5: Understand MOQs & Lead Instances
– Small MOQ (1–5 kg) → Great for startup companies (e. g., fisetin, apigenin, gardenia yellow)
– Large MOQ (25–100 kg) → Better pricing for established brands (e. g., berberine, green tea extract extract)
– Guide times: 7–14 times for stock items, 20–30 days regarding custom extracts

🌏 Part 5: Typically the Regulatory Reality Look at
For U. T. & EU Potential buyers:
– NMN cannot be sold being a dietary supplement within the U. S i9000. (FDA preclusion), but can be imported via cross-border elektronischer geschäftsverkehr to China. Paradoxical? Yes.
– NAD is generally recognized as safe (GRAS) for supplements.
– Astaxanthin from They would. pluvialis is totally legal, but manufactured astaxanthin is not really for human supplements.
With regard to China Domestic Revenue:
– NMN seemed to be added to the health food registration checklist in 2025, yet enforcement remains rigid for unapproved product sales.
– Natural pigments (gardenia yellow, safflower yellow, sodium copper mineral chlorophyllin) are fully approved as food additives (GB 2760).
– Botanical concentrated amounts must comply using Chinese Pharmacopoeia specifications if sold while APIs.
